Gunman Kills 2 US Police Officers

A gunman has shot dead two police officers sitting inside a patrol car in New York before killing himself.

The head of the New York police said the men had been “targeted for their uniform”. The gunman then ran into a subway station where he shot himself, the BBC reported.

Earlier he had posted anti-police messages on social media.

President Barack Obama - who is on holiday in Hawaii - said he condemned the killings unconditionally.

The mayor of New York, Bill de Blasio, said anyone who saw postings indicating a threat to the police should report them to the authorities. The “whole city was in mourning” after the shootings, he said.

The shootings come at a time when New York City police are facing intense scrutiny for their tactics, according to the BBC.

Earlier this month, a grand jury did not indict any New York police department officer in the chokehold death of Eric Garner, a black man who died when white police officers tried to arrest him for selling cigarettes.

The decision sparked protests in New York and other cities across the US.
